On May 17, the mass spectrometry research team of the Department of Precision Instrumentation of Tsinghua University published a report on the single-cell lipid group fine structure characterization technology based on mass spectrometry, which realized large-scale fine structure analysis of lipids in mammalian single cells and solved the field of single-cell mass spectrometry.

Mass spectrometer has become the main technique for single-cell lipidome analysis due to its high sensitivity, high specificity and accurate quantitative ability
The study uses this new technology to carry out single-cell fine lipidomics analysis on wild-type (HCC827) and drug-resistant (HCC827/GR6) non-small cell lung cancer (NSCLC) cells, and realizes a lipid-based C=C Differentiation of sensitive and drug-resistant lung cancer cells by isoform analysis
Related work was recently published in Nature Communications under the title of "Single-cell lipidomics with high structural specificity by mass spectrometry"
The first author of this article is Li Zishuai, a PhD student in the Department of Precision Instrument, and the corresponding authors are Associate Professor Ma Xiaoxiao and Professor Ouyang Zheng of the Department of Precision Instrument.
